Sacramento, CA - Pedestrian Critically Injured in Crash on Norwood Ave

Sacramento, CA (May 16, 2025) – A 50-year-old man was struck by a vehicle and critically injured Friday morning near the intersection of Norwood and Eleanor Avenues, according to the Sacramento Police Department.

The incident occurred just before 8:30 a.m. Responding officers and paramedics transported the victim to a local hospital. Officials say he is not expected to survive his injuries.

The driver involved remained at the scene and is cooperating with the investigation. Authorities have ruled out drugs and alcohol but are examining whether distracted driving played a role.

Norwood Avenue was closed between Eleanor and Las Palmas Avenues as detectives conducted a detailed reconstruction of the scene.
